US troops arrest 11 Taliban in Afghanistan
2008-03-16
(KUNA) -- The US-led coalition forces said they had detained 11 Taliban militants during a joint operation with Afghan troops in the southeastern zone. A statement released from the coalition forces' Bagram base here on Friday said the suspected militants were captured in Khost province. All those held were accused of having links with foreign fighters and were allegely involved "in improvised explosive devices attacks and weapons facilitations," said the statement.

In a separate operation, the Afghan and coalition troops discovered "a number of improvised explosive device (IED) making materials, several hand-grenades, small-arms, ammunition and ammunition vests", the statement said.

On Thursday, a homicide bomber attacked a two-vehicle convoy of the American forces in Kabul killing six civilians and injuring 15 more. It was learnt later that four soldiers traveling in the convoy were slightly injured. Earlier, a similar attack was carried out on a convoy of Canadian troops in the southern province of Kandahar which also caused civilian casualties. The Thursday suicide attack in Kabul was staged after a lull of more than 20 days.
